SAFETY PRECAUTIONS
Check with your state and local public works department
for plumbing and sanitation codes. You must follow these
guidelines as you install the Household Water Filtration
Housing. Using a qualified installer is recommended.
Be sure the water supply conforms with the
Specifications
Guidelines
. If the water supply conditions are unknown,
contact your municipal water company
.
W ARNING:
Do not use with water that is
microbiologically unsafe or of unknown quality without adequate
disinfection before or after the system.
I
t is highly recommended that a water shut-off valve be placed
directly upstream of your household filter.
PROPER INSTALLATION
Check with your local public works department for plumbing codes.
You must follow their guides as you install the Household Water
Filtration Housing.
Use the Household Water Filtration Housing on a potable, safe-to-
drink, home COLD water supply only. The filter cartridge will not
purify water or make unsafe water safe to drink. DO NOT use on
HOT water (100˚F max).
Protect the Household Water Filtration Housing and piping from
freezing. Water freezing in the housing will damage it.
Your Household Water Filtration Housing will withstand up to 125 psi
water pressure. If your house water supply pressure is higher than
100 psi during the day (it may reach higher levels at night), install
a pressure-reducing valve before the housing is installed.
Do not install on
HOT WATER
. The temperature of the water
supply to the Household Filtration Housing must be between the
minimum of 40
°F and the maximum of
1
00°F
. See the
Specification Guidelines
.
Do not
install the Household Water Filtration
Housing
using
copper solder fittings. The heat from the soldering process
will damage the unit. If making a soldered copper installation,
do all sweat soldering before connecting pipes to the housing.
Torch heat will damage plastic parts.
W ARNING:
Discard all unused parts and packaging
material after installation. Small parts remaining after installation
could be a choke hazard.
Do not
install filter in an outside location or anywhere it will be
exposed to sunlight.

The GXWH20S system using FXUSC (Rev. 2)
filter is tested and certified by NSF
International against NSF/ANSI Standard 42
for reduction of particulate Class V.
This GXWH04F is tested and certified by
NSF International against NSF/ANSI
Standard 42 for materials and structural
integrity requirements only.
COMPONENT
The FXUSC (Rev. 2) filter is tested and
certified by NSF International against
NSF/ANSI Standard 42 for materials
requirement only.
COMPONENT
The GXWH20S has been tested and
Certified by WQA according to CSA B483.1.
